Colerain violent crime is 21.7. (The US average is 22.7)
Colerain property crime is 59.0. (The US average is 35.4)
NOTE: The city of Colerain, North Carolina does not have FBI Crime Statistics. The closest similar sized city with FBI crime data is the city of Edenton, North Carolina.
